shop/ components/ uln2803a darlington driver - 8-channel solenoid/stepper

Practical Solenoid for Maker, Student, and Prototype Builds

The Stepper ULN2803A 8 Channel Darlington Driver Solenoid Unipolar is a practical solenoid from Circuitrocks for students, makers, and repair-friendly builds. It fits well in projects that need linear actuation, while keeping setup straightforward for testing and prototype work.

Compared with generic parts, this product stands out through details such as Unipolar motor. That makes it a solid choice for Arduino, ESP32, Raspberry Pi, robotics, motion-control, and workshop projects where matching the right part from the start saves time.

Important: Always match the electrical rating, size, and control method of this part with the rest of your setup before full-power testing.

Why you'll love it

  • Unipolar motor design: a familiar format for many learner-friendly stepper setups
  • Straightforward linear action: adds useful value when choosing parts for a build
  • Useful for lock or latch tasks: adds useful value when choosing parts for a build
  • Simple trigger-based movement: adds useful value when choosing parts for a build
  • Good for push-pull mechanisms: adds useful value when choosing parts for a build

What you can build

This product is a good fit for locks, push-pull actions, latches, and simple linear motion projects. It works especially well in student projects, quick repairs, and prototype builds where part availability, straightforward hookup, and predictable results matter.

Starter bundles

Plan for a matching power supply, a proper driver stage where needed, and a controller if you want timed, remote, or sensor-based operation.

Recommended add-ons

Useful add-ons include brackets, springs, latches, and a proper driver stage. You can also compare it with Solenoid Electromagnetic Lock, Solenoid Lock Cabinet.

Comparison table

Compared Product Best For Key Difference Direct Link
Solenoid Electromagnetic Lock linear actuation Solenoid Electromagnetic Lock View product
Solenoid Lock Cabinet linear actuation Solenoid Lock Cabinet View product
Solenoid Large Push-Pull linear actuation Solenoid Large Push Pull View product

Technical specifications

Product Stepper ULN2803A 8 Channel Darlington Driver Solenoid Unipolar
Brand Circuitrocks
Product Type Solenoid
Primary SKU 970
Key Specs 500mA, 50V, unipolar
Product URL https://circuit.rocks/products/stepper-uln2803a-8-channel-darlington-driver-solenoid-unipolar

Pinout & power notes

Drive the solenoid with a suitable transistor or relay and add proper protection where needed. The controller should only provide the signal, not the full load current.

What’s in the box

1 × Stepper ULN2803A 8 Channel Darlington Driver Solenoid Unipolar

Frequently Asked Questions

Can this work with Arduino or similar boards? Yes, as long as the voltage, control method, and wiring match your controller and power supply.
Should I power it directly from a controller pin? For small signal-only modules that may be fine, but motors, pumps, solenoids, and relays should use a proper driver or external supply.
Is this good for student and prototype builds? Yes. It fits well in testing, learning, and proof-of-concept projects when matched with the right support parts.
How do I choose the right version? Check the size, voltage, torque, speed, current, and fit details that matter most for your project.

Build with this board

// from learn.circuit.rocks

Notes from the bench

// from blog.circuit.rocks

Ask the community

// from forum.circuit.rocks